Sistema de recomendación para la toma de decisiones de inversión basado en análisis fundamental

Abstract

El análisis bursátil siempre ha tenido un papel importante en el mundo del sector financiero, sobre todo relacionado con la toma de decisiones de en qué empresa invertir. Dentro de este existen dos tipos de análisis bien diferenciados, el análisis técnico centrado en la visión de gráficos y resultados de fórmulas matemáticas complejas a partir del historial de cotizaciones y volúmenes. Y por otro lado, el análisis fundamental centrado en entenderla situación actual de la empresa basándose en gran medida en el balance y en las cuentas de pérdidas y ganancias. Estos análisis han sido muy utilizados para decidir las inversiones de las IIC (Instituciones de inversión colectiva), por lo que es más que evidente que en plena era tecnológica tengan que existir herramientas que faciliten estos tipos de análisis y les ayuden a tomar decisiones a los gestores, lo cuales son los encargados de decidir en qué invertir. Actualmente existen muchas aplicaciones y páginas web que dan información de estos análisis, pero ninguna con el objetivo de automatizar todo el proceso que realizan los gestores. En este trabajo fin de máster se ha realizado un estudio previo del análisis bursátil, centrado sobre todo en la parte de análisis fundamental, con la intención de entender el problema y poder diseñar una aplicación que se adapte perfectamente a las necesidades que existen respecto a este tipo de análisis. Esta aplicación diseñada tiene como objetivo ser un sistema de soporte a la decisión que pueda dar recomendaciones al usuario de en qué activos de renta variable invertir y también en cuales dejar de hacerlo. Todo este sistema es parametrizable para que se pueda adaptar a cada gestor, algo importante en el análisis fundamental donde es muy determinante el conocimiento de éste. Esto es posible porque los usuarios pueden crearse sus indicadores de forma que especifiquen que significa cada resultado y combinar estos con un sistema de pesos, que es lo que llamamos estrategia. Esta aplicación consta de muchas funcionalidades, donde las más importantes es recibir recomendaciones a partir de estrategias creadas por el usuario, la automatización del cálculo de indicadores, la obtención de datos referentes a empresas de forma fiable, poder poner a prueba dichas estrategias en el pasado por medio de la técnica de backtesting, un sistema de autoajuste de dichas estrategias o como el envío de órdenes a mercado desde dicha aplicación. Debido a la complejidad de la aplicación y el tiempo que conllevaría el desarrollo total de la aplicación, este trabajo fin de máster también tiene asociado un pequeño prototipo capaz de hacer recomendaciones, el cual es una pequeña toma de contacto con la aplicación final a desarrollar.The stock-market analysis always has had a great importance along of years in the financial sector, particularly in the decision making of where to invest. Inside this one there are two types of analysis well-differentiated, the technical analysis focused on the vision of quotations graph and complex mathematical formulas and the fundamental analysis focused on understand the actual situation of the company based on the balance sheet and the profit and loss account. These analyses have been very used with the objective of deciding the investment of the CII’s (Collective Investment Institutions). Therefore, it is obvious that in full technological age has to exist tools that facilitate these types of analysis and help to take decisions to the investment managers, who are who decide in what to invest. Actually there are many applications and web sites which offer information about theses analyses, but none with the goal to automate the whole process that the investment managers do. In this Master project, I have done a previous study of stock-market analysis, focused in the fundamental analysis, with the intention of understand the problem and can design an application which can resolve the hardship of this type of analysis. This designed application takes as to be a decision support system could give recommendations to the user of in what equities invest and also which fail to do so. This whole system is parametrical so that it can be adapted to each investment manager, something very important in the fundamental analysis where the knowledge of this manager is very decisive. This is possible because the users can create their own indicators specifying that means the result of the fundamental indicator and combine these with a weight system, which is called strategy. This application has many features, where the most important are receive recommendations from strategies created by the user, the automation of the calculation of indicators, the collection of data about companies, able to test the strategies in the past through the backtesting technical, a system of self-adjustment of the strategies or send order to the markets. Due to the complexity of the application and the time that would bear the entire development of the application, this Master project also has associate a small prototype able to do recommendations, which is a small initial contact with the final application to development.Máster Universitario en Tecnologías de la computación aplicadas al sector financiero. Curso 2016/2017. 1ª edició

    Similar works